Linear problem/question

BIll inherited $25,000 and invested part of it in a money market account, part in bonus bonds and part in a mutual fund. After one year, he received a total of $1,620 in simple interest from the three investments. The money market paid 6% annually, the bonds paid 7% annually, and the mutual fund paid 8% annually. There was $6000 more invested in the bonds than the mutual funds.


• Set up and solve a system of equations to find the amount Tyrone invested in each category.
